#include #include #include #include #include #include #include #include #include #include #include #include using namespace std; int main() { int n; cin >> n; map mp; for (int i = 0; i < n; i++) { int l; cin >> l; mp[l]++; } int mx = 0; int ans = 0; for (auto a : mp) { if (mx <= a.second) { ans = max(ans, a.first); mx = a.second; } } cout << ans << endl; }